Based on the analysis of treatment of 2650 patients with acute intestinal obstruction studied the causes of adverse outcomes. This is atypical and effaced of clinical presentation, increased percentage of occlusive colon tumors, late arrival of patients, the overestimation of the effectiveness of conservative therapy, factual and tactical errors in the preoperative, intraoperative and postoperative periods.Features of medical care for patients with acute intestinal obstruction is originality of diagnostic and medical procedures are often complicated course, running form of acute intestinal obstruction due to late hospitalization of patients and the effectiveness of using innovative technologies of diagnosis and treatment.

Periodontal disease of athletes is mainly represented by chronic catarrhal gingivitis, which is often exacerbated in a state of overtraining. Ane lack of efficacy in the treatment of an exacerbated disease. May be some changes in the immune status. Anti-inflammatory treatment of exacerbation of chronic catarrhal gingivitis in athletes in a state of overtraining less effective without reducing exercise, whereas a decrease in volume and intensity of the overtraining increase effectiveness of treatment because it promotes the restoration of functions of local immunity and nonspecific defense factors of the impaired by excessive physical and psycho-emotional stress.

It was established, that the long receipt of extreme permit acceptable concentration (EAC) of acetate lead results in generation of free radical oxidation in microsomal fraction of the investigated organs of experimental animals. Alongside with it the increase of pheromones’ activity of antioxidation system (AOS) is marked, that it is possible to consider as adequate compensate- adaptating reaction on a leaden intoxication.
